Unit commanders play a crucial role in leading and managing their teams effectively. However, the demanding nature of their roles can often lead to burnout if self-care practices are not prioritized. The Professional Certificate in Analyzing the Importance of Self-Care in Preventing Burnout for Unit Commanders is essential to equip these leaders with the necessary skills and knowledge to maintain their well-being and prevent burnout.
According to a survey conducted by the Health and Safety Executive, work-related stress, depression, or anxiety accounted for 51% of all work-related ill health cases in the UK in 2020/21. This highlights the pressing need for unit commanders to prioritize self-care and mental health in order to prevent burnout and maintain peak performance.
